Products & Materials
Rescued Relics stocks an extensive selection of reclaimed barn wood including original chestnut beams, antique heart pine flooring, and weathered oak siding with authentic patina developed over decades of exposure. Their inventory features both rough-sawn and planed options, with thickness ranging from 1-inch boards to massive 12×12 timbers perfect for structural or decorative applications.
Specialty products include live-edge slabs for custom furniture projects, reclaimed mantels and architectural elements, and custom-milled lumber cut to your exact specifications. Popular species include American chestnut, old-growth pine, white oak, hemlock, and poplar, many sourced from barns and structures dating back to the 1800s and early 1900s.
Value-added services include professional de-nailing, custom planing and milling, kiln-drying when needed, and delivery for larger orders. They can match existing reclaimed wood for restoration projects or help you select complementary pieces for new construction that requires an authentic, aged appearance.

Tips for First-Time Buyers
- Bring project dimensions and photos to help staff recommend appropriate pieces and calculate quantities accurately
- Expect variations in color and character – examine multiple boards to select pieces that work well together
- Ask about the provenance and age of materials if authenticity documentation is important for your project
- Inquire about custom milling services if you need specific dimensions or profiles not available in stock
- Plan for additional time and tools if you want to hand-select individual boards for your project
- Consider the moisture content and stability of reclaimed materials for your specific application
